Navy discharge certificates offered to World War veterans

Naval personnel are urged to apply for victory buttons and discharge certificates for services in the Navy during the World War. Applications can be made in person or by mail at this office with hours from 8 a.m. to 7 p.m. daily. Information is available to interested veterans.

Survey of U P Church in Pittsburgh on family prayer revival

In Pittsburgh on January 27, a report notes the United Presbyterian church campaign to revive religion at home by restoring Bible reading and family prayer at the evenings. Dr J Knox Montgomery advocates reviving the tradition as families drift from prayer to moviegoing.

Church Survey Encourages Family Prayer Altar Pledge

The church surveys 55000 to 60000 families to gauge rebirth of home prayer. A Family Altar Scene formed, with heads of households urged to pledge daily home prayer. Pledges logged at the New World Movement office in Ninth Street, noting member name and congregation.
